Latest Patents

Cassandra's latest patents include a "Slurry phase reactor with internal cyclones." This innovative system processes hydrocarbon feeds by utilizing a final stage reactor and an internal separator with cyclones. The design allows for the formation of a substantially gas stream and a substantially non-gas stream, with the gas stream being sent directly to further downstream processing. Another notable patent is for "Integrated desolidification for solid-containing residues." This process enables the isolation and extraction of solid additives from unreacted petroleum residue streams. It plays a crucial role in hydrocracking processes by mixing solid additives with petroleum residue feedstock, ultimately converting the residue into higher-value distillates.
